Заполнить случайными значениями поле datetime - Forum 3Dnews Tech
Вернуться   Forum 3Dnews Tech > Софт > Программное обеспечение > Программирование
Вход через: 

 
 
Опции темы Опции просмотра
Старый 13.06.2013, 01:07   [включить плавающее окно]   Вверх   #1
mrbob
Мужской Новенький
Автор темы
 
Регистрация: 04.06.2013
Заполнить случайными значениями поле datetime

Здравствуйте!
Нужно заполнить таблицу случайными значениями.
Вызвало трудность заполнение поля типа datetime.
[code=sql]
DECLARE @MyDatetime datetime,
SET @MyDatetime = '01/05/2013 00:01'
INSERT INTO mytable
VALUES (DATEADD (MINUTE, FLOOR(59*RAND()), @MyDatetime))
[/code]
Так меняются только минуты.
Как сделать что бы часы, дни, месяцы и годы менялись последовательно т.е. минуты будут увеличиваться на случайное значение. Например было 45 минут, а стало 57 минут, потом 17 минут и когда стало 17 час увеличился на один и так дальше т.е. потом например стал 35 минут, а после 5 минут и час снова увеличился еще на 1.
Если такое реализовать не возможно, то подскажите хотя бы как вообще можно заполнить поле datetime случайными значениями.
ms sql
mrbob вне форума  
Ответить с цитированием
 


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.

Быстрый переход


Текущее время: 14:37. Часовой пояс GMT +3.


Powered by vBulletin® Version 3.8.4 Patch Level 5
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d. Перевод: zCarot